It’s a crash bar. The first year superduty didn’t have them. My 99 sits tall from the factory and I guess when they rear ended cars the trucks tend to ride up as they hit. So the crash bar is designed to catch the car. Sort of like the rear of a tractor trailer has the metal bar that hangs diwn.so when a yahoo n a low slung sports car hits the back they dint go in under the trailer
